| ASCOMS organizes blood donation camp | | | Early Times Report Jammu, Oct 3: To commemorate October Ist as national voluntary blood donation day, Acharya Sri Chander College of medical science and hospital at Sidhra organized a voluntary blood donation camp here today. During the camp doctors, students, paramedical staff of ASCOMS donated blood, besides other social organizations. Speaking on the occasion Prof and head blood bank said that for the population of 1.2 billion, estimated requirement of blood in the country is 12 million units annually while the present annual collection of blood is 8.5 million units. Thus there is a shortage of 3.5 million units inspite of 2607 blood banks functioning in 35 states and union territories. She said to bridge the gap between demand and supply promotion of voluntary blood donation and separation of blood units into various components is the only solution. Out come of shortage of blood units results in malpractice, denial of access of blood to needy patients, infact nearly one third of all maternal deaths in the country are on account of non availability of blood. Consultant Dr. Urmil Verma, Dr. Bhawna Raina, Dr Poonam Sharma, Dr. Mala, Dr. Farahna actively participated in the camp. Earlier the camp was inaugurated by director Dr. SS Sodan.
